What to Know

Critics Consensus

Gotham successfully delivers on a fun origin story, even if the big twist at the end of "The Last Laugh" feels unearned.

Episode Info

Synopsis Gordon faces off with Jerome (Cameron Monaghan); a magic show at a gala for the Gotham Children's Hospital becomes a hostage situation.
